Przeglądam programy studiów różnych uczelni i natrafiłam na ciekawy przedmiot - Matematyka dla informatyków (zamiast analizy matematycznej). Zadania robi się w Matlab lub Octavie. Egzamin odbywa się przy komputerze. Czy to jest trudniejsze od tradycyjnej Analizy matematycznej? czym się różni?
Jeśli nie podasz nazwy uczelni to nikt nie udzieli Ci odpowiedzi na to pytanie, ponieważ na różnych uczelniach / wydziałach ten przedmiot może wyglądać inaczej. Upewnij się tez, że ten przedmiot jest zamiast analizy a nie oprócz, albo jeden z dodatkowych. Jeżeli zamiast to zapewne robi się tam to samo co na analizie matematycznej bo trudno mi sobie wyobrazić studiowanie informatyki bez tego przedmiotu. Poza tym możesz zerknąć w opis przedmiotu, możliwe że jest tam napisane coś więcej i porównać z klasyczną analizą.
Mi ten przedmiot wygląda raczej na zwykłe "metody numeryczne" i na 100% nie jest "zamiast" analizy ;]
Program studiów: https://wfa.uni.wroc.pl/info/?sc=3939
Sylabus: https://wfa.uni.wroc.pl/info/pub/content/3802/files/Matematyka%20dla%20informatyk%C3%B3w.pdf
Jest jeszcze w drugim semestrze Matematyka dla informatyków 2, ale nie ma sylabusa. Ogólnie chodzi mi czy trudniej robi się zadania matematyczne w programie Matlab, pytam bo nie wiem co to w ogóle jest...
Zależy od zadania. Ktoś może dać Ci takie zadanie, że nie rozwiążesz go ani na kartce ani w Matlabie albo takie, że mądrzejsza małpa dałaby sobie radę więc nie ma reguły. Ogólnie znajomość programów tego typu się przydaje na studiach.
Jak dla mnie ten przedmiot wygląda jak miks analizy z metodami numerycznymi po prostu. Więc pewnie będzie trochę tego i trochę tego.
Ale tak generalnie to te studia wyglądają tragicznie jeśli chodzi o program. W zasadzie nie wiem kogo chcą tam wyprodukować na tych studiach, ale teoretycznej informatyki w programie 0, programowania ledwo co, Algorytmy i Bazy Danych na 6 semestrze to już jakaś farsa a do tego jeszcze LabView i kupa elektroniki analogowej.
Shalom napisał(a):
Jak dla mnie ten przedmiot wygląda jak miks analizy z metodami numerycznymi po prostu. Więc pewnie będzie trochę tego i trochę tego.
Ale tak generalnie to te studia wyglądają tragicznie jeśli chodzi o program. W zasadzie nie wiem kogo chcą tam wyprodukować na tych studiach, ale teoretycznej informatyki w programie 0, programowania ledwo co, Algorytmy i Bazy Danych na 6 semestrze to już jakaś farsa a do tego jeszcze LabView i kupa elektroniki analogowej.
Bez przesady, jest dosyć sporo programowania. Wstęp do programowania (w C), PROGRAMOWANIE W C++, Zaawansowane programowanie C++(opcjonalnie), JĘZYKI SKRYPTOWE - PYTHON, PROGRAMOWANIE APLIKACJI WWW, PROGRAMOWANIE URZĄDZEŃ MOBILNYCH.
No właśnie nie za bardzo bo to są wszystko przedmioty pokazujące taki czy inny język, a mi chodzi o przedmioty na których faktycznie coś się pisze :) Widzę tam takie przedmioty 2 wiec może bez tragedii, ale i tak jak dla mnie to trochę bieda jak praktycznie samo C i C++.
Shalom napisał(a):
No właśnie nie za bardzo bo to są wszystko przedmioty pokazujące taki czy inny język, a mi chodzi o przedmioty na których faktycznie coś się pisze :) Widzę tam takie przedmioty 2 wiec może bez tragedii, ale i tak jak dla mnie to trochę bieda jak praktycznie samo C i C++.
Rzeczywiście trochę kiepsko, ale tak już w Polsce jest... większość uczelni ma jedynie C++ na poziomie zaawansowanym... Chociaż mi się udała znaleźć uczelnie z Javą na poziomie zaawansowanym(jako przedmiot dodatkowy, opcjonalny) w Opolu, więc kto szuka ten znajdzie ;)
s napisał(a):
(...) Rzeczywiście trochę kiepsko, ale tak już w Polsce jest... większość uczelni ma jedynie C++ na poziomie zaawansowanym... (...)
C++ na poziomie zaawansowanym to trzeba parę lat systematycznego kodzenia w tym języku :). Więc wątpię, żeby jakaś uczelnia miała C++ na poziomie zaawansowanym :).
Marszal napisał(a):
s napisał(a):
(...) Rzeczywiście trochę kiepsko, ale tak już w Polsce jest... większość uczelni ma jedynie C++ na poziomie zaawansowanym... (...)
C++ na poziomie zaawansowanym to trzeba parę lat systematycznego kodzenia w tym języku :). Więc wątpię, żeby jakaś uczelnia miała C++ na poziomie zaawansowanym :).
No wiadomo, że to nie jest faktycznie taki poziom. Mała korekta - C++ na poziomie "zaawansowanym".
A co złego jest w elektronice analogowej? Wygląda na to, że kształcą bardziej pod embedded niż pod typowe programowanie.
Z tego co się od kogoś dowiedziałam to ten program - Matlab sam oblicza, trzeba jedynie nauczyć się pisać jakieś funkcje. Więc chyba łatwiej?
Ty tak serio czy to troll? Matlab udostępnia po prostu środowisko do programowania w ichnim języku, wspierającym obliczenia numeryczne. Tu masz przykład jak wygląda np. napisanie MESa w matlabie: https://www.particleincell.com/2012/matlab-fem/
Żeby to zrobić to musisz nie dość że rozumieć jak to działa i jak to policzyć na kartce, to jeszcze musisz ogarniać matlaba zeby to zaklepać ;]